Abstract

The present invention discloses a strapless, backless adhesive shaping breast lift that is suitable for lifting and holding larger breasts in position. Further, the design of the strapless, backless adhesive shaping breast lift comprises two breast support structures, wherein each of the breast support structures comprises a plurality of tabs at the upper portion and a plurality of scallops at the bottom portion of the brassiere, so as to maintain a round breast shape, even on a larger cup size. The adhesive material allows a user to pull the plurality of the tabs and scallops to adjust the shape of the brassiere while distributing the weight of the breast on the tabs and scallops. Further, circular cuts between the tabs help to maintain a round shape of the breast by minimizing the size and number of creases on the brassiere.

[0030] The present invention discloses a strapless, backless brassiere 100 that is referenced in FIGS. 1A, 1B, 4, 5A, 6A and 7. The design of the strapless, backless brassiere 100 comprising two breast support structures 101 which are two-dimensional stickers, wherein each of the breast support structures 101 comprise at least three tabs 102a-c at the upper portion 108 and at least three scallops 104a-f at the bottom portion 110 of the brassiere 100, so as to maintain a round shape of the breasts of a user, even on a larger cup size. The adhesive material allows a user to pull the tabs 102a-c and the scallops 104a-f to adjust the shape of the brassiere 100 while distributing the weight of the breast on the tabs 102a-c and scallops 104a-f. Further circular cuts 106a-b between the tabs 102a-c eliminate formation of pointed structures 112 when the tabs 102a-c are brought together towards each other. Additionally, the scallops 104a-f at the lower portion 110 of the brassiere 100 allow the reduction of the number and depth of creases 114 formed on the brassiere 100. The tabs at both sides 102a, 102c pull the sides of the breast inward to create a round shape of the breast while distributing the weight of the breast to be shared by three attach points 102a-c of each tab 102a-c over a larger surface area. The at least three tabs 102a-c transform the two-dimensional sticker into a three-dimensional shape on the body in order to support larger breasts from United States sizes 36-38B up to and including 30-32I (United Kingdom sizes 36-38B up to and including 30-32G) cup size in a round shape, substantially in accordance with the size chart below:

[0041] However, examples of two types of conventional, prior art breast lift products 300 and 400 are shown in the FIGS. 2A-3B that lift the breasts from above the nipple, causing the breast shape to become pointed at the nipple area. In contrast, the brassiere 100 of the present invention lifts the breasts from under the breast to ensure that the breast shape remains round in appearance on larger cup sizes. A front view of the first conventional brassiere shown in FIG. 2A is a teardrop shaped adhesive lift brassiere 300 and its side view is shown in FIG. 2B illustrating only one tab 302 that takes the weight of the breast at a single point. Further it does not have slashes or cuts to create a dart effect on the body, thereby causing a large breast to become flattened, which is deemed to be an unflattering shape. The front view of the second conventional adhesive lift brassiere 400 shown in FIG. 3A and its side view shown in FIG. 3B illustrate the brassiere 400 supporting only the upper portion of the breasts, to lift the breasts thereby creating a pointed appearance of the breasts. These conventional designs, 300 and 400, lack a plurality of tabs, cuts between the tabs and scallops, and are thus unable to support larger breasts and also insufficient to provide a round shape to the breasts without bra creases.

[0043] Another exemplary embodiment of the brassiere 100 of the present invention as referenced in FIG. 5A showing the breast support structure 101 which is a two-dimensional sticker (FIG. 4) that transforms into a three-dimensional shape when worn on the breast of a user. The first and the second cuts 106a-b between the tabs 102a-c eliminate formation of pointed structures 112 when the tabs 102a-c are brought together towards each other. FIG. 5B shows the formation of pointed structures 112 or creases 114 when no cuts 106a-b are provided between the tabs 102a-c while the tabs 102a-c are brought together towards each other. Further the cuts 106a-b allow each of the tabs to act as an independent structure that distributes the weight of the breast across the attach points of each tab 102a-c, thus allowing the support of larger breasts from United States sizes 36-38B up to and including 30-32I (United Kingdom sizes 36-38B up to and including 30-32G) cup size. Further, the first tab 102a and the third tab 102c at the periphery allow a user to pull the sides of the breast inward to create a round shape of the breast.

[0044] Another exemplary embodiment of the brassiere 100 of the present invention as referenced in FIG. 6A shows the plurality of scallops 104a-f at the lower portion 110 of the brassiere 100 that allow the reduction of the number and depth of creases 114 formed on the brassiere 100. FIG. 6B shows the formation of creases 114 as it does not have one or more scallops at the lower portion of the brassiere 100.
